Terms & Conditions of Sales
- Auctioneer or any other member of A-1 Auctioneers makes no representations or warranty as to age, condition, or any other details concerning items in this sale.
- All items are sold as is/ where is, no exceptions.
- Method and advancement on any bid solely at the Auctioneers discretion.
- In case of disputed bid, Auctioneer has sole right to determine successful bidder or if the item should be put up for resale.
- Successful bidder, on any item, understands this to be a legal contract between buyer and seller.
- Buyers premium charged on all purchases.
- Applicable taxes applied to all purchases.
- Ten percent deposit may be required on absentee bids.
- Terms of payment are cash, approved cheque, Interac or Visa/Mastercard.
- All goods to be removed from auction site day of sale, unless special arrangements have been made.
- Auctioneer or owner of goods will not be responsible for accidents, theft, loss or damage on the day of sale.
- The seller or any one person on his behalf may bid on and purchase any item.
- Auctioneer reserves the right to remove any item from the auction if a sufficient bid is not received.
